Kaleb Johnson Visits With Bengals

University of Iowa running back Kaleb Johnson visited with the Cincinnati Bengals on Thursday after visiting with the New York Giants on Wednesday, sources told The Bergen Record's Art Stapleton. The Bengals currently have the 49th and 81st overall picks in this year's NFL draft in Rounds 2 and 3, respectively, and it seems clear that they want to give Chase Brown help in the backfield via this year's draft. Cincy has brought in multiple RBs for visits during the pre-draft process, including Ohio State star Quinshon Judkins. They are scheduled to meet with Judkins' teammate, TreVeyon Henderson, as well. Johnson had a whopping 1,537 rushing yards and 21 touchdowns in 2024 and added 22 catches for 188 yards and two more TDs. If the Bengals like the 21-year-old enough, they may have to trade up in the draft to select him.

Shedeur Sanders Camp Prefers If He's Taken Outside Of Top Three Picks?

ESPN analyst Louis Riddick said on Wednesday that he thinks Colorado quarterback Shedeur Sanders' camp doesn't want him to be drafted by the Cleveland Browns or the other teams that have the top three picks in this year's NFL draft. The Tennessee Titans hold the top pick, but they are expected to take Miami QB Cam Ward. The Browns and New York Giants hold the second and third picks, respectively. There is momentum for the Browns to take Sanders' Colorado teammate and Heisman Trophy winner Travis Hunter at No. 2 overall, leading to speculation of how far Sanders might fall in the top 10 later this month. If Sanders falls outside the top three picks, the Raiders at No. 6, the Saints at No. 9 and the Steelers at No. 21 could all be good landing spots for him. The Steelers are expected to sign Aaron Rodgers eventually, but Sanders would become their long-term plan at the position.

Mo Alie-Cox Remaining With Colts

The Indianapolis Colts have re-signed tight end Mo Alie-Cox to a one-year deal on Friday. Alie-Cox is headed back to Indy for a eighth straight season. In 2024, Alie-Cox finished with 12 receptions for 147 yards and one touchdown in 17 games (13 starts) with the Colts. At this point, Alie-Cox is mainly depth as the Colts are likely to target a tight end during the upcoming NFL Draft. Regardless, it's hard to imagine Alie-Cox having fantasy value considering he hasn't posted a season with over 200 receiving yards since 2021. This appears to be a depth signing as Alie-Cox knows the system and the organization well.

Josh Johnson Joins Commanders

The Washington Commanders have agreed to a one-year deal with free-agent quarterback Josh Johnson. The veteran signal-caller is back with the organization after playing four games with Washington during the 2018 season. Most recently, Johnson played with the Baltimore Ravens during the 2024 season as the backup to Lamar Jackson. Now, Johnson is set to serve as the third string behind Jayden Daniels and Marcus Mariota. The 38-year-old is mainly a veteran presence at this point in his career considering he hasn't started a game since 2021. Johnson has played with seven different organizations since being traded by the Tampa Bay Buccaneers in 2008. He won't offer much value on the field, but can be a helpful mentor on the sideline.

Joe Flacco Heading Back To Cleveland

The Cleveland Browns have signed free-agent quarterback Joe Flacco on Friday. They've agreed on a one-year, $4 million contract, including incentives that could earn up to $13 million for the upcoming season. The 40-year-old threw for 1,761 passing yards with 12 touchdowns and seven interceptions with the Indianapolis Colts last season. Before that, Flacco went 4-1 with the Browns while throwing for 1,616 passing yards with 13 touchdowns and eight interceptions during the 2023 campaign. The Browns already have Kenny Pickett and the No. 2 overall pick in the upcoming NFL Draft. That being said, it's unclear where Flacco is going to fall on the depth chart once the season begins. For now, Flacco is looked upon as a veteran presence who might still have a little bit left in the tank on the football field.
